Arts at the Farm

We converted a garden building in the middle of the Northlands Urban Farm into “The Red Shed Gallery” for Alberta Cultural Days. I exhibited paintings from my Urban Garden series in the space. Some of the source material for the paintings was photographed at the farm the year before. People entered from the side of the large acre garden in the centre of the city, and the doors of the shed were propped open so that the gallery was the first thing they saw as they entered the Urban Farm. It was so appropriate to have the art in this setting surrounded by the plants, bees and flora of the farm.
